London's tech scene is increasingly adopting OpenTelemetry as businesses prioritize observability to maintain resilient systems. For professionals skilled in OpenTelemetry, the city offers opportunities across DevOps, platform engineering, and site reliability roles focused on enhancing telemetry pipelines and data-driven operations. The convergence of open standards and cloud-native architectures in London companies means expertise in OpenTelemetry is becoming a valuable asset.

Experienced engineers looking for roles involving OpenTelemetry in London should expect to engage deeply with distributed tracing, metrics collection, and logging standardization to support operational excellence. Many positions require integrating OpenTelemetry frameworks into existing monitoring stacks, emphasizing practical knowledge of instrumentation and data correlation. This technical focus is complemented by the need to analyze telemetry data to anticipate and resolve performance issues.

For those based in London, opportunities involving OpenTelemetry span sectors from finance to technology startups, reflecting the diverse adoption of observability tools across industries. The roles typically involve collaboration with engineering and operations teams to design and maintain telemetry solutions that improve service reliability. Understanding the nuances of OpenTelemetry's SDKs and protocols enhances a candidate's ability to contribute effectively to scalable, cloud-oriented infrastructures.
